Key Concepts in Currency Conversion

  1. Exchange Rate: The exchange rate determines how much one currency is worth in terms of another. For example, if the 68 euros to dollars exchange rate is 1.20, you get $81.60 for €68.
  2. Fluctuations: Exchange rates fluctuate based on economic factors like inflation, interest rates, and political stability. For instance, during economic uncertainty, the euro may weaken against the dollar.
  3. Currency Pairs: Currency pairs, such as EUR/USD, show the relative value of one currency against another. In this case, EUR/USD indicates how many dollars you get for one euro.

Factors Influencing Exchange Rates

  • Economic Indicators: Metrics like GDP growth, employment rates, and manufacturing output influence exchange rates. Strong economic performance typically strengthens a currency.
  • Interest Rates: Central banks set interest rates, impacting currency values. Higher interest rates often attract foreign capital, increasing demand for the currency.
  • Political Events: Elections, policy changes, and geopolitical tensions can affect currency stability. For example, Brexit significantly impacted the euro and the British pound.

Practical Tips for Currency Conversion

  • Monitor Rates: Keep an eye on exchange rates if you plan a significant conversion. Tools like Google Finance can alert you to rate changes.
  • Avoid Airport Exchanges: Airport kiosks often have less favorable rates. Convert your money at a bank or online before traveling.
  • Use Credit Cards: Many credit cards provide competitive exchange rates with minimal fees. Ensure your card doesn’t charge foreign transaction fees.

Current Exchange Rate

The exchange rate fluctuates based on economic factors. As of October 2023, 1 euro equals approximately 1.05 US dollars. Therefore, converting 68 euros to dollars results in around 71.40 USD. Check reliable sources, such as the European Central Bank or financial news websites, for the latest rates. Exchange rates can vary slightly between banks and online converters.

Historical Exchange Rates

Examining historical exchange rates provides context for current rates. Over the past year, the EUR/USD rate ranged between 1.00 and 1.20. Economic indicators, interest rates, and geopolitical events influence these fluctuations. For instance, major political events in the EU or US can cause significant changes. Understanding these patterns aids in predicting potential future trends. Sites like XE.com or OANDA offer tools for reviewing historical data.

Economic Indicators

Economic indicators like GDP growth rates, unemployment rates, and inflation rates significantly influence exchange rates. For example:

  • GDP Growth Rates: A strong GDP indicates a robust economy, leading to higher demand for the currency.
  • Unemployment Rates: Lower unemployment rates usually signal a healthy economy, which can increase currency value.
  • Inflation Rates: High inflation devalues a currency, while low inflation increases its value.

Central banks monitor these indicators closely to adjust monetary policies, affecting exchange rates. For instance, when the European Central Bank raises interest rates, the euro strengthens against the dollar. You should watch these indicators to predict currency value changes.

Political Stability and Market Speculation

Political stability and market speculation also play crucial roles in exchange rate movements. For instance:

  • Political Stability: Countries with stable political environments attract more foreign investments, strengthening their currency. Conversely, political turmoil can lead to currency depreciation.
  • Market Speculation: Traders in forex markets often speculate on future currency movements, impacting current exchange rates. Speculative activity can lead to short-term volatility.

Market perception of political events, such as elections or policy changes, affects investor confidence, influencing exchange rates. For example, if the US experiences political instability, the dollar might weaken against the euro. Monitoring news and expert analyses can help anticipate these changes, aiding in better currency conversion decisions.
